I still have to wrap the harness up, make the vaccume system out of SS and clean up a little bit of wiring that was thrown in to make it run.



This winter I might do a major rewire and put the fuseboxes up with the computer.



I am proud to report that there are zero leaks of any type. I had a problem with my turbo oil feed line exploding. Lesson learned, always keep the fitting and hose brand consistant, earls fittings and aeroquip hose are not happy together, especally with 120psi of 50 weight running through it at idle...
